Ani DiFranco matters because she reshaped the landscape of singer-songwriter music, bringing a fierce sense of independence and activism into the mainstream. Her unapologetic examination of personal and societal issues has inspired a generation of artists to embrace authenticity while encouraging listeners to confront uncomfortable truths in their own lives. By carving out her own path in an industry often resistant to female voices, DiFranco has fostered a deeper connection between artistry and social consciousness. Her approach is characterized by a DIY ethos that permeates her music production and performance style. DiFranco's commitment to self-releasing albums and her grassroots touring strategies have set a precedent for artists seeking autonomy over their work. This hands-on methodology not only amplifies her message but also cultivates an intimate atmosphere during live performances, drawing audiences into a shared experience that feels both personal and communal. Lyrically, DiFranco often explores themes of feminism, love, identity, and social justice through a voice that balances sincerity with irony. Her storytelling is vivid and emotionally charged, presenting both intimate narratives and broader critiques of society. With playful yet poignant language, she crafts songs that resonate on multiple levels, inviting listeners to reflect deeply on their own experiences while engaging in a larger dialogue about the world around them.
